Abstract

The invention discloses a molding method for phyllanthus emblica trees and belongs to the technical field of fruit tree culture management. According to the method, 4 to 6-year-growth strong disease-and-pest-free wild phyllanthus emblica fruits are selected for seeding during the rootstock culture; a rootstock is cut off in a position with a distance being 8 to 10cm from the ground and is grafted; when scion sprouts grow to 17 to 20cm and branches are semi-lignified, compound fertilizers and calcium magnesium phosphate fertilizers are applied; when the height of grafting seedlings reaches 80 to 100cm, topping is carried out; when the height of tree crown is higher than 1.2m, 3 to 4 branches are selected and reserved for each plant to be cultured as primary branches, and the primary braches maintain an angle being 80 to 90 degrees; when the primary branches grow to 1.0 to 1.2m, the topping is carried out, secondary branches with the base part space being 25 to 35cm are selected and reserved, the secondary branches and the primary branches maintain an angle being 50 to 60 degrees, and fruiting trees are trimmed. The method has the advantages that the problems that the internal cavity of the phyllanthus emblica tree plant gradually grows, and the fruit setting rate and the yield are reduced are successfully solved. The acre yield of phyllanthus emblica reaches 332 to 372kg.

Background technology
Emblic ( Phyllanthus emblica L.) be Euphorbiaceae ( Euphorbiaceae) Leafflower ( Phyllanthus) plant, tropical and subtropical zone deciduous tree or shrub.Height of tree growth is rapid in early days for emblic; Along with increasing height of tree speedup, the age of tree slows down; But leading thread continues to increase with the hat width of cloth, and behind the entering fruiting period, the power of branching out also dies down with the increase of the age of tree; The young sprout average length also progressively diminishes, and the shoot growth direction is main lateral growth by main upwards growth alteration also.The inner empty thorax of plant increases along with the increase of the age of tree, and resultant layer more and more shifts to the tree crown top, although the height of tree, the hat width of cloth still increase to some extent, its as a result area gradually reduce on the contrary, emblic output is more and more lower.Therefore,,, must take certain measure, adjust the tree body structure of emblic, increase area as a result, to improve the solid ability of plant in the different age of tree stage that emblic grows to the Changing Pattern that the emblic tree crown is grown.
Summary of the invention
The technical problem that the present invention will solve be emblic along with the age of tree increases, the inner empty thorax of plant also increases,
Area gradually reduces as a result, causes output to reduce, and a kind of plastotype method of emblic subtree is provided for this reason.
For solving the problems of the technologies described above, the plastotype method of a kind of emblic subtree provided by the present invention may further comprise the steps:
(1) stock is cultivated
Selected 4 ~ 6 years to give birth to the healthy and strong wild emblic seedling tree that does not have damage by disease and insect again, as the seed collecting elite stand; Gather emblic fruit ripe on the said elite stand autumn; The fruit of gathering removed take out seed after pulp will be planted the nuclear broken shell, with seed dry to moisture collecting 11% below, sow to 2 ~ March of next year; To reach 0.8 ~ 1.0m high when height of seedling, and basic diameter stem reaches and carries out grafting more than the 1cm;
(2) grafting
All can carry out grafting from spring to autumn, adopt the cut-grafting method to carry out grafting, this method is simple, and survival rate is high; During cut-grafting with stock from cutting off apart from ground 8 ~ 10cm, the equating section is rived from the section center; The degree of depth 6 ~ 8cm; The joint-cutting of stock is inserted in scion, and a strain stock inserts a scion, uses the plastic strip colligation then; The full life in 1 ~ 2 year of axillalry bud is selected in scion for use, and length is that 8 ~ 10cm and diameter stem are the branch of the improved seeds of 0.8 ~ 1.1cm;
(3) managing after grafting
With garden ground, stock and scion water spray keep ground, garden moistening after the grafting, prevent that the burning sun fringe bar that is exposed to the sun from drying out wiltingly, and situation alive is checked in grafting after 20 days, in time mend to connect and the lateral bud of in time erasing the stock sprouting; When 17 ~ 20cm is grown in the scion rudiment, during the branch semi-lignified, remove the plastic strip of colligation, impose fertilizer, described fertilizer is made up of composite fertilizer and fused calcium magnesium phosphate, in mass fraction, total nutrient in the described composite fertilizer>=45%, N-P 2O 5-K 2O is 15-15-15; P in the described fused calcium magnesium phosphate 2O 5>=20%, MgO>=12%, SiO 2>=20%; Composite fertilizer 0.3 ~ 0.4kg is used in every strain, and fused calcium magnesium phosphate 0.5 ~ 0.6kg is used in every strain;
(4) the tree-like cultivation of treelet
When grafting height of seedling 80~100cm, pinch; When crown height 1.2m is above, open Zhi Lajiao, whenever select good strains in the field for seed and stay 3 ~ 4 branches to cultivate as the one-level branch, the one-level branch with restricting traction and fixation on the timber on ground, is made to keep about 80 °~90 ° angle between each one-level branch; When the one-level branch grows to 1.0 ~ 1.2m; Pinch, when the secondary branch grew to 60 ~ 70cm, the spacing between the secondary branch base portion of selecting and remain was at the secondary branch of 25 ~ 35cm; Prune all the other secondary branches off; The secondary branch that keeps with restricting traction and fixation on the timber on ground, is made to keep 50 °~60 ° angle between secondary branch and the one-level branch, and treelet draws branch to carry out 2 ~ 3 years;
(5) bearing-age tree is pruned
A. the described secondary branch of step (4) that surpasses 60-80cm is carried out pinching or cutting back;
B. wipe out the damage by disease and insect branch before blooming, slim and frahile branch and intersection branch;
C. wipe out damage by disease and insect branch, slim and frahile branch and the branch that intersects after the fruit picking, the cutting back diameter is the branch group of 1.5 ~ 2.0cm, and cutting back branch group amount accounts for tree crown 18~22%, year by year cutting back retraction tree crown by turns.
The described grafting time of step (2): the axillalry bud of scion in spring expand and not sprouting period be best grafting time.

Embodiment
The embodiment of embodiment 1 the inventive method
Implement the place: academy of agricultural sciences, Yunnan Province hot-zone ecological agriculture research institute Hou Shan proving ground
Present embodiment adopts the inventive method to do 3 processing, and three repetitions are established in each processing.
The concrete steps of processing 1 are following:
1. stock is cultivated
Selected 4 years to give birth to the healthy and strong wild emblic seedling tree that does not have damage by disease and insect again, as the seed collecting elite stand.Gather the wild emblic fruit of maturation on the elite stand autumn, after fruit is gathered, remove and take out seed after pulp will be planted the nuclear broken shell, seed is dried to moisture collect 11%, to next year, sow for promptly in February, 2005.After planting to note water management and fertilizing and weeding, make the nursery stock normal growth.Specifically be to adopt conventional moisture and fertilizing and weeding management by methods: the farmers''s rich water with 1% when seedling grows 4-5 to leaf sprays, and whenever at a distance from 20 days once, along with nursery stock grows up, increases fertilizing amount, reduces fertilizer application frequency.When seedling growth after 7 days, in time remove the weeds of growth on every side.To reach 0.8~1.0m high when height of seedling, and basic stem reaches slightly that 1cm is above just can to carry out grafting.
2. grafting
The cut-grafting method is adopted in grafting, and its method is simple, and survival rate is high.The March in spring in 2007, the axillalry bud of scion expands and grafting when not sprouting, during grafting with stock from cutting off apart from ground 8 ~ 10cm; The equating section is rived from the section center, the about 6 ~ 8cm of the degree of depth; With length is the joint-cutting of the scion insertion stock of 8 ~ 10cm, and a strain stock inserts a scion, uses the plastic strip colligation tight then; Stock and fringe bar are closely linked, can in time heal, sprout rapidly.The full life in 1 ~ 2 year of axillalry bud, the branch of the improved seeds of thick 0.8 ~ 1.1cm are selected in scion for use.The branch of improved seeds is meant: robust growth, no damage by disease and insect, the branch of life in 1 ~ 2 year on the maternal plant tree crown of stable high yield continuously.
3. managing after grafting
After the grafting with garden ground, stock and scion water spray, moistening with keeping the garden, prevent that the burning sun fringe bar that is exposed to the sun from drying out wilting.Seedling grafting will be checked into situation alive after 20 days, promptly mended to connect, and in time erased the lateral bud that stock is sprouted.As the long 17 ~ 20cm of scion rudiment, during the branch semi-lignified, just to remove plastic strip, and impose fertilizer, described fertilizer is made up of composite fertilizer and fused calcium magnesium phosphate, and composite fertilizer 0.3kg is used in every strain, and fused calcium magnesium phosphate 0.5kg promotes that the fringe blastogenesis is long; Described fertilizer is made up of composite fertilizer and fused calcium magnesium phosphate, in mass fraction, and total nutrient in the described composite fertilizer>=45%, N-P 2O 5-K 2The ratio of O is 15-15-15; P in the described fused calcium magnesium phosphate 2O 5>=20%, MgO>=12%, SiO 2>=20%; Composite fertilizer 0.3 ~ 0.4kg is used in every strain, and fused calcium magnesium phosphate 0.5 ~ 0.6kg is used in every strain.
4. the tree-like cultivation of treelet
When grafting height of seedling 80~100cm, in time pinch, impel branch, through increasing branch progression, enlarge tree crown fast, when crown height 1.2m is above, open Zhi Lajiao.Whenever selecting good strains in the field for seed, 3~4 branch positions are reasonable, the branch of robust growth is cultivated as the one-level branch.Behind selected one-level branch, with branch with the cord traction and fixation on the timber on ground, make between each one-level branch to keep 80 ° ~ 90 ° angle, all the other branches are dredged and are removed.When the long 1.0 ~ 1.2m of one-level branch, pinch, impel the secondary branches of sprouting on the one-level branch more.When the long 60 ~ 70cm of secondary branch, dredge and remove the overstocked secondary branch of growth, make spacing between each secondary branch base portion at 25~35cm.With the secondary branch that remains with the cord traction and fixation on the timber on ground, make between secondary branch and the one-level branch to keep 50 ° ~ 60 ° angle.Treelet draws branch generally will carry out 2 ~ 3 years, otherwise the major branch branch that draws back also recovers vertical growth easily.
5. bearing-age tree is pruned
(a) bearing-age tree is pruned and is focused on the upwards outwards passing of control tree crown, and the described secondary branch of step 4 that surpasses 60-80cm is carried out pinching or cutting back;
(b) the preceding pruning of blooming: wipe out the damage by disease and insect branch, slim and frahile branch intersects branch;
(c) prune after the fruit picking: wipe out damage by disease and insect branch, slim and frahile branch, intersect branch, the cutting back diameter is the branch group of 1.5 ~ 2.0cm, and cutting back branch group amount accounts for tree crown 18~22%, year by year cutting back retraction tree crown by turns.
In the process of growth of above-mentioned emblic subtree, press emblic subtree conventional fertilizer application management method, the emblic subtree is intertilled fertilising, weeding management, by conventional pest control method the emblic subtree is carried out the extermination of disease and insect pest.As the annual Spring Festival to autumn, every mu sprays weeding to the weeds cauline leaf, annual 2 ~ 3 times after converting water with glyphosate 1.5kg.The emblic root growth is very fast, should approach fertile diligent fertilising, and fertilizer is main with nitrogenous fertilizer, compounding application phosphorus potash fertilizer, annual 3 ~ 5 times.Note the control of damage by disease and insect behind the grafting survival, aphid is the primary pest of emblic, takes place very generally, and control should be grasped before the blooming of early April, 1000 times of liquid of the dimethoate emulsifiable concentrate with 40% or 1000 times of liquid of 25% phosmet missible oil spray.
